Transaction 14528559f433fd7921ac3474cc58a18a3b69ea6a3b5ee5b4d156a8b1d002cdf1
1 Input
1 Output
-
14528559f433fd7921ac3474cc58a18a3b69ea6a3b5ee5b4d156a8b1d002cdf1:0
- value
- 512364
- script pubkey
- OP_0 OP_PUSHBYTES_20 00c1ffacc614cc019cb767f9442a98581f17087f
- address
- bc1qqrqlltxxznxqr89hvlu5g25ctq03wzrlh4t6x5